![]() I. Ostheimer | Federal (USV)PrivateIsaac Ostheimer(c. 1831 - 1864)Home State: New York Branch of Service: Infantry Unit: 66th New York Infantry |
Before the Antietam Campaign: Enlisted at age 30 in New York City on 14 October 1861, in Company F, 66th New York Infantry. In the Antietam Campaign: Wounded in action at Antietam on 17 September 1862. The remainder of the War: Killed in action on 10 May 1864 at Spotsylvania, VA. References, Sources, and other notes: Basic information from State of New York1, who list him as Osthimeir.
